Everyone agreed the Marchetti was a remarkable flying airplane, but for the right seat specifically because most military pilots will fly with the right hand on We seemed to always have an airplane in the family, from a 1948 Wheels Up: The Story of Our Bonanza Partnership 1970 A36 I am the proud owner and pilot of the July Beechcraft of the Month, which will also be the ABS 50th an ATP (my rating ride was in a Beech 18), and eventually an airline This book is about flying freight in an aircraft known as the Beech 18. It includes my stories, and stories from others, about a time when small air cargo loads were flown around the US in this iconic airplane.
